final
Оновлено: 22.05.2023
❮ Ключові слова Java
Встановіть для змінної значення final, щоб запобігти її перевизначенню/модифікації:
final
public class Main {
final int x = 10;
public static void main(String[] args) {
Main myObj = new Main();
myObj.x = 25; // will generate an error: cannot assign a value to a final variable
System.out.println(myObj.x);
}
}
Визначення та використання
Останнє ключове слово - це модифікатор недоступності, який використовується для класів, атрибутів і методів, що робить їх незмінними (неможливими для успадкування або перевизначення).
Ключове слово final корисне, коли ви хочете, щоб змінна завжди зберігала те саме значення, наприклад, PI (3.14159...).
Останнє ключове слово називається "модифікатор". Ви дізнаєтеся більше про них у розділі Модифікатори Java.
Пов'язані сторінки
Дізнайтеся більше про атрибути у нашому підручнику з атрибутів класів Java.
❮ Ключові слова Java